Features Considerations for Timing of Piling and Underpinning Projects:

Weather Conditions:

Dry Season:

Ideally, piling and underpinning projects should be started during dry weather conditions. Excessive rain can cause waterlogged soil, making the ground unstable and difficult to work with. Dry conditions ensure better soil stability and easier handling of equipment.

Temperature:

Moderate temperatures are preferable. Extreme cold can freeze the ground, making excavation difficult and increasing the risk of equipment malfunction. Conversely, extreme heat can pose health risks to workers and affect the curing time of concrete.

Soil Conditions:

Soil Moisture:

The moisture content of the soil significantly affects piling and underpinning. Dry or moderately moist soil provides a stable base for these operations, while saturated soil can make driving piles or achieving effective underpinning difficult.

Soil Type:

Understanding the soil type through geotechnical surveys helps determine the best time for construction. Some soil types are more manageable during specific seasons, influencing the timing of the project.

Site Accessibility:

Site Preparation:

Ensure that the site is cleared, and access roads are constructed before starting the project. This includes removing any existing structures, vegetation, and debris that could hinder the movement of machinery and materials.

Traffic and Congestion:

Consider local traffic patterns and avoid starting projects during peak traffic times or events that could cause congestion. This certifies flatter transportation of materials and gear to the site.

Environmental Regulations:

Permits and Approvals:

Securing necessary permits and approvals from local authorities can impact the start date. Ensure all regulatory requirements are met well in advance to avoid delays.

Environmental Impact:

Consider the environmental impact of your project. Some locations have restrictions during certain times of the year to protect wildlife or comply with environmental regulations.

Project-Specific Considerations:

Project Timeline:

Coordinate with other phases of the construction project. Starting piling and underpinning at the right time ensures that subsequent stages can proceed without delays.

Resource Availability:

Ensure that the required resources, including skilled labour, machinery, and materials, are available before commencing the project. Shortages can cause significant delays and increase costs.

Best Times for Starting Piling Projects:

Spring:

Advantages:

Spring is generally a good time for starting piling projects. The weather is typically mild, and the soil begins to thaw and dry out after winter. This makes it easier to handle the ground and use heavy machinery.

Considerations:

Ensure that spring rains do not lead to overly wet conditions that could affect soil stability.

Summer:

Advantages:

Summer offers extended daylight hours, allowing for longer workdays and faster project completion. The ground is usually dry and stable, facilitating easier piling operations.

Considerations:

Be aware of heat waves, which can cause health hazards to labourers and affect concrete solidifying times. Appropriate hydration and planning work during cooler divisions of the day can alleviate these hazards.

Early Autumn:

Advantages:

Early autumn provides favourable weather conditions similar to summer but with cooler temperatures. This is a suitable time to start piling projects as the ground remains dry and stable.

Considerations:

Plan to complete major groundwork before late autumn rains begin, which can complicate piling activities.

Best Times for Starting Underpinning Projects:

Late Spring to Early Summer:

Advantages:

Starting underpinning projects in late spring or early summer ensures that the ground is dry and temperatures are moderate. These conditions are ideal for excavation and concrete work involved in underpinning.

Considerations:

Avoid starting too early in spring when the ground might still be wet from winter thaw.

Autumn:

Advantages:

Early autumn is another good period for underpinning projects. The weather is stable, and the ground remains dry from the summer months.

Considerations:

Ensure the project is well underway before late autumn rains and colder temperatures set in, which can affect excavation and concrete curing.
